Skip to content
101 changes: 51 additions & 50 deletions .github/workflows/all_stages_icd_tests.yml
Original file line number Diff line number Diff line change
Expand Up @@ -19,15 +19,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and All @@ -50,7 +50,7 @@ jobs:
port: 9005
steps:
- name: Checkout
uses: actions/checkout@v4
uses: actions/checkout@v6
with:
repository: CARTAvis/carta-backend
ref: ${{ env.CARTA_BACKEND_BRANCH_NAME }}
Expand Down Expand Up @@ -91,6 +91,7 @@ jobs:
if: matrix.os == 'macos' && matrix.os_version != 'macOS-14'
shell: bash
run: |
export Protobuf_ROOT="/opt/homebrew/opt/protobuf@21"
SRC_DIR=$GITHUB_WORKSPACE/source
BUILD_DIR=$GITHUB_WORKSPACE/build
cd $SRC_DIR && git submodule update --init
Expand Down Expand Up @@ -155,15 +156,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and All @@ -187,7 +188,7 @@ jobs:
needs: Build
steps:
- name: Checkout
uses: actions/checkout@v4
uses: actions/checkout@v6
with:
path: ICD-RxJS

Expand Down Expand Up @@ -235,15 +236,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-290,15 +291,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-345,15 +346,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-400,15 +401,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-455,15 +456,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-510,15 +511,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-565,15 +566,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-620,15 +621,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-675,15 +676,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-730,15 +731,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-785,15 +786,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-840,15 +841,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-895,15 +896,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down Expand Up @@ -950,15 +951,15 @@ jobs:
fail-fast: false
matrix:
include:
- os_version: macOS-13
os: macos
runner: [macOS-13, ICD]
- os_version: macOS-14
os: macos
runner: [macOS-14, ICD]
- os_version: macOS-15
os: macos
runner: [macOS-15, ICD]
- os_version: macOS-26
os: macos
runner: [macOS-26, ICD]
- os_version: ubuntu-22.04
os: linux
runner: [self-hosted, Linux, Apptainer, ICD2]
Expand Down
Loading